McMahon, Joan Kissik was born on July 20, 1944 in New York City. Daughter of Edward and Jessie Kissik.

Public health nurse, Yonkers (New York) Department Public Health, 1966-1967; public health nurse, Lockport (New York) Department Public Health, 1967-1970; staff relief nurse, Homemakers Upjohn, Niagara Falls, New York, 1971-1978; staff nurse rehabilitation, U. Kansas, Kansas City, 1978-1980; assistant head nurse, U. Kansas, Kansas City, 1980-1981; head nurse, U. Kansas, Kansas City, 1981-1983; rehabilitation clinician, Swope Ridge Rehabilitation Hospital, Kansas City, Missoury, 1983-1986; program manager, Bethany Rehabilitation Center, Kansas City, Kansas, 1986-1992; administrative director, Bethany Rehabilitation Center, Kansas City, Kansas, 1992-1994; admissions coordinator, Bethany Rehabilitation Center, Kansas City, Kansas, since 1995.
Volunteer Kansas Head Injury Association, Overland Park, 1986-1990. Board president Old Shawnee Town Marching Band, Shawnee, Kansas, 1989-1992. Member Association Rehabilitation Nurses (founder, president Greater Kansas City chapter 1984-1986, chairman education committee 1988-1990, president elect 1991-1992, president 1992-1993, national nomination scom. since 1995, presenter conference 1991).
Married Shaun Q. McMahon, August 19, 1967. Children: Shaun Allen, Rebecca Marie, Christopher Patrick.
